Parallelität

Parallelität ist ein in der Informatik verwendeter Begriff, der die Fähigkeit eines Systems beschreibt, mehrere Vorgänge in überlappenden Zeitrahmen abzuwickeln. Dadurch können mehrere Aufgaben gleichzeitig ausgeführt werden, um den Systemdurchsatz zu erhöhen und die Systemressourcen zu optimieren. Parallelität wird typischerweise durch die Verwendung von Threads oder Prozessen erreicht, bei denen es sich um separate Einheiten handelt, die jeweils über eigene Code- und Datenstrukturen verfügen.

In der Informatik bezeichnet Parallelität die Vorstellung, dass mehrere Berechnungen effektiv gleichzeitig ausgeführt werden können. Dies ist wichtig für parallele Hardwarearchitekturen, verteilte Systeme und andere komplizierte Computersysteme. Es ist eine Schlüsselkomponente der Softwarearchitektur, die für jedes System notwendig ist, das letztendlich mehrere Berechnungen in überlappenden Zeitrahmen effizient ausführt. Dazu gehören Mikroprozessoren, Cluster, Multiprozessoren und Grid Computing.

Das Konzept der Parallelität gibt es schon seit vielen Jahren, aber die Umsetzung hat sich im letzten Jahrzehnt erheblich weiterentwickelt. Parallelität kann genutzt werden, um die Effizienz und Skalierbarkeit in Softwaresystemen zu steigern. Durch die Aufteilung komplexer Aufgaben in kleinere, besser verwaltbare Teile ermöglicht die Parallelität einem System, mehrere Aufgaben gleichzeitig zu verarbeiten und stellt gleichzeitig sicher, dass die Aufgaben nicht miteinander in Konflikt geraten. Darüber hinaus ermöglicht die Parallelität, Aufgaben auf die effizienteste Art und Weise zu erledigen, indem Aufgaben entsprechend geplant werden.

Parallelität ist unerlässlich, damit Datenbanksysteme Tausende gleichzeitiger Anforderungen verarbeiten können, ohne dass sie überlastet werden. Es kann auch in verteilten Computersystemen verwendet werden, um Vorgänge zu beschleunigen und Reaktionszeiten zu verkürzen. Darüber hinaus kann Parallelität ein leistungsstarkes Werkzeug in Cloud-Computing-Umgebungen sein, da sie die gleichzeitige Verarbeitung mehrerer Anfragen von mehreren Clients ermöglicht.

Es gibt verschiedene Möglichkeiten, Parallelität zu erreichen, unter anderem durch Techniken wie Threading, Multitasking und Multiprocessing. Diese Techniken werden häufig in Kombination verwendet, um das gewünschte Maß an Parallelität zu erreichen. Darüber hinaus stehen eine Reihe von Frameworks zur Unterstützung der Parallelität zur Verfügung, z. B. Node.js, .NET, Java und Go.

Insgesamt ist Parallelität ein grundlegender Bestandteil der Computerwelt. Es wird in fast allen Bereichen der Datenverarbeitung eingesetzt, von der Softwareentwicklung bis hin zum Cloud Computing, und ist für jedes System, das darauf ausgelegt ist, mehrere Berechnungen effizient und überlappend auszuführen, von wesentlicher Bedeutung.

Proxy auswählen und kaufen

Passen Sie Ihr Proxy-Server-Paket mühelos mit unserem benutzerfreundlichen Formular an. Wählen Sie den Standort, die Menge und die Laufzeit des Service aus, um sofortige Paketpreise und Kosten pro IP anzuzeigen. Genießen Sie Flexibilität und Komfort für Ihre Online-Aktivitäten.

Wählen Sie Ihr Proxy-Paket

Proxy auswählen und kaufen